The report described the investigations conducted to provide a 'Pneuma-Grip' handling device for large solid propellant rocket motors to minimize problems associated with lifting, rotating and transporting of large and heavy rocket propulsion systems. The 'Pneuma-Grip' utilizes flexible pneumatic members (tires) normally encased within annular channel-shaped retainers. This rigid framework affords a maximum of structural strength and the tires, when inflated, provide the gripping forces required for both horizontal or vertical lifts and normal transport requirements.
